Hayley Manning & Catherine Mousley present Time To Talk TFMR with their guest Sue Clachers, a bereavement support practitioner with the national charity Child Bereavement UK.Today we are talking about parenting after loss. We discuss with Sue about navigating the tricky questions about death our children may ask – how do we achieve ‘age appropriate’ answers? We also explore explaining death to children and how to cope with our own grief while trying to be parents.Whether you have living children or not, we are all still parenting after loss. How does this look for you? We discuss continuing bonds - how does your dead baby grow with you over time, milestone marking and incorporating them into our families.Please follow Child Bereavement UK on Instagram & Facebook @childbereavementuk and Twitter @cbukhelp.
